Transaction 824382c33f71a581f226a915744c4e21429b9f311f32132eaa59ce92764dadd6

1 Input
2 Outputs
  • 824382c33f71a581f226a915744c4e21429b9f311f32132eaa59ce92764dadd6:0
  • value  8983
    address  39rUK6H1MF6UbunsvqqatGUycEwKMwm1oa
  • 824382c33f71a581f226a915744c4e21429b9f311f32132eaa59ce92764dadd6:1
  • value  21563
    address  1PgMbVyMRuUfPCEip3fQRkKUBP1spdmMFv